Hi folks,

I have a problem...
Yesterday i bought an Ipod video 30gb.
Works perfect,but is was curious 'bout the rockbox!
So i installed today,and it works!
I listen even a track on it!
Then i changed a Theme,and that works too.
After another change of a Theme,he returned to the default  Theme :S.
But i thought,''whatever'' you know,and i switched it off.

NOW i can't get my ipod on again (aaaaaaaaaaahhhhhhh!!!).

I tried the thingy menu+play,and that Hold on,then off then menu+play and NOTHING worked.
I tried to connect with usb,dead.
I tried to give 'm more power with a usb,to wall-power converter,DEAD!(ya know what is mean)

I very sad with this problem man,i bought it yesterday!

I hope anybody can help!!!!

Hi,

try pressing MENU + SELECT instead of MENU +PLAY.

Charge it for a while, and then try again.  Unless there is a hardware problem. the Menu+Select reset sequence will always work.
